Before Gotham heads out on its winter hiatus, expect some major fireworks when Carmine Falcone (John Doman) makes his way back to town, complicating an already delicate situation between Jim Gordon (Ben McKenzie), Sophia Falcone (Crystal Reed), and the Penguin (Robin Lord Taylor). 

The hour will also have Alfred (Sean Pertwee) doing his best to bring Bruce Wayne (David Mazouz) out of his downward spiral. Meanwhile, Nygma (Cory Michael Smith) will continue to struggle gaining control over his Riddler persona and Tabitha (Jessica Lucas) will attempt to break through to Grundy (Drew Powell). 

Watch the new promo for episode eleven, titled "Queen Takes Knight," below:

Things get complicated for Gordon, Sophia and Penguin when Carmine Falcone (guest star John Doman) comes to town. Alfred tries to get through to Bruce once and for all, while Nygma struggles to gain control over The Riddler persona and Tabitha attempts to make Grundy remember his past. Meanwhile, a familiar smile resurfaces in Gotham in the all-new "A Dark Knight: Queen Takes Knight" fall finale episode of GOTHAM airing Thursday, Dec. 7 (8:00-9:01 PM ET/PT) on FOX.


 
Season Four of Gotham will witness the emergence of the criminal landscape for which Gotham City is best known, with GCPD Detectives Jim Gordon and Harvey Bullock at the forefront of the fight against the most depraved and unhinged villains. While Gotham City fights for normalcy, a new hero will rise, as Bruce Wayne begins to assume responsibility for the city’s well-being.
